Popular NBA player asked to be expelled from Binance lawsuit!

Professional basketball player Jimmy Butler has sought expulsion from the lawsuit by Binance for alleged involvement in the promotion of unregistered securities.

Calls from lawyers to Binance and celebrities

The basketball star’s lawyers claimed that he did not mention any alleged securities, but instead warned about celebrities promoting crypto investments. They claimed that Butler’s tweets did not suggest any investment and instead helped out with celebrity crypto endorsements. Additionally, they urged potential Binance clients to do their own research on crypto investments.

Butler, CEO of Binance in March class action lawsuit Changpeng “CZ” Zhao and YouTubers Graham Stephan and Ben Armstrong, known as BitBoy Crypto. In 2022, Binance signed with Butler, the All-Star of the National Basketball Association Miami Heat, to promote the change on the way to that year’s Super Bowl. It was first featured on February 2, 2022 in a video from Binance promoting a free collection of nonfungible tokens (NFTs). Butler tweeted two more videos later that month on February 7 and February 13.
